Spleen tyrosine kinase is usually a cytoplasmic protein expressed mainly in immune cells together with macrophages and neutrophils and it is related with receptors containing an immunoreceptor tyrosine primarily based activation motif, this kind of as Fcg receptors.

As Syk mediated signaling plays a crucial part BYL719 solubility in activation of immune responses, to investigate regardless of whether particular interruption of Syk mediated signaling can impact the growth of rheumatoid arthritis, we utilized tamoxifen induced conditional Syk KO mice to evaluate the importance of Syk on condition advancement. Making use of a collagen antibody induced arthritis model, iSyk KO mice showed appreciably attenuated illness severity compared to Syk non deleted mice. While iSyk KO mice contained decreased B cell numbers right after deletion of Syk in adulthood, B cells are usually not necessary for arthritis improvement in CAIA, as demonstrated by making use of muMT mice which lack B cells. On the flip side, Syk deficient macrophages made much less MCP 1 and IL 6 than Syk adequate cells after FcR ligation, which could account for the absence of a pronounced accumulation of neutrophils and macrophages while in the joints of iSyk KO mice.

Our outcomes Lymph node show that Syk in macrophages is most likely a crucial player in antibody induced arthritis, mediating the release of pro inflammatory cytokines and chemokines just after macrophages bind anti collagen antibody, and indicate that Syk is actually a promising target for arthritis treatment. Rheumatoid arthritis is consists of a number of processes this kind of as chronic irritation, overgrowth of synovial cells, joint destruction and fibrosis. To clarify the mechanism of outgrowth of synovial cells, we carried out immunoscreening using anti rheumatoid synovial cell antibody, and cloned Synoviolin. Synoviolin is endoplasmic reticulum resident E3 ubiquitin ligases, and it is involved with ER associated degradation.

Synoviolin is highly expressed in synoviocytes of clients with RA. Overexpression of synoviolin in transgenic mice leads to state-of-the-art arthropathy caused by lowered apoptosis of synoviocytes. We postulate that the hyperactivation of your ERAD pathway by overexpression of synoviolin results in prevention of ER pressure induced apoptosis leading to synovial hyperplasia. In addition, selleck product Synoviolin ubiquitinates and sequesters the tumor suppressor p53 within the cytoplasm, thereby negatively regulating its biological functions. Thus Synoviolin regulates, not simply apoptosis in response to ER worry, but in addition a p53 dependent apoptotic pathway. These scientific tests indicate that Synoviolin is associated with overgrowth of synovial cells by way of its anti apoptotic results. Additional examination showed that Synoviolin can also be involved with fibrosis between the various processes.
